Serena and Venus Williams WILL NOT attend their nephew’s funeral as the half-sister slams stars and King Richard for missing contact

SERENA and Venus Williams are expected to snub the memory of their late nephew this weekend – but his mum won’t shed a tear over it.
Sabrina Williams is her oldest half-sister from Papa Richard’s first marriage. He left Sabrina’s mother when she was only eight years old, saying he would buy her a bike, and never returned.

But Sabrina, 57, never had the attention the Williams sisters had from their father, she only saw him a couple of times into their adult years, and he hasn’t even seen his two grandchildren, the late Alphonse and Elijah.


In February, depressed Alphonse, who was struggling with mental health issues, took his own life at the age of 21 by overdosing.
The memorial service will be held this Saturday, May 21, in his hometown of Las Vegas.
But there was no confirmation from Richard or Serena, no card, no phone call, nothing. Sabrina had expected nothing less.
She says, “Even my close friends have said, ‘Have you heard about the sisters?’
“I’ve heard from my other blood relatives, but I haven’t heard from them or my father, and they’re like, ‘Well, how do you feel about them?’
“I do not care. You are dead to me. You are not stupid, you saw on the news that Alphonse is not here.
“We haven’t spoken to each other for a long time, but I would at least appreciate it if I were her, send a card.
“Now when people ask, I actually laugh, it makes me laugh because I’m like, ‘Okay, I’ll move on’.”
Sabrina, a hospice chaplain and committed mental health activist, wants the service to not only celebrate Alphonse’s life but also highlight the need for people to be there for one another.
Her own childhood was tough growing up in poverty in Los Angeles County with five other siblings after Richard left. She doesn’t want anyone to suffer in silence.
She expects over 120 people to attend the service at Spring Valley Baptist Church, where a 20-strong choir will sing and Sabrina and her ex-husband will deliver eulogies.

People will be dressed in characters from Alphonse’s favorite Marvel and Batman films, while Sabrina will wear a Catwoman t-shirt. She hands out self-care bags filled with inspirational cards and sweets, even organic lollipops for vegans.
After the service, people will enjoy fried chicken and Superman, Batman and Wonder Woman cupcakes, with Sabrina and Elijah, 23, taking the leftovers to the homeless.
“My husband is going to speak about my son and her life and I heard the speech today, it’s beautiful. But I want to talk about the real elephant in the room. Mental health. Suicide. Did you know that suicide can be prevented? says Sabrina.
“And today there’s probably someone sitting in this room feeling lost or lonely. Even if you don’t know this person very well, talk to them. Because people need people. people don’t want to die. They only need one person to hear them. Just one.
“Don’t be afraid to ask a question. Covid times have caused people to struggle with loneliness. If you don’t use this gift bag, maybe you can give it to that person to encourage them.
“Some people call it a funeral, but I want to celebrate his life, so I call it a memorial.”


Alphonse was cremated a few weeks earlier and now his ashes sit in Sabrina’s lounge in an engraved Batman locker, where she says “he’d just want to be”.
All donations go to the American Foundation for Suicide Prevention, where Sabrina has set up a fundraising page.
